Different ethical situations require different homiletical responses. John McClure organizes recent literature on ethics and preaching into four ethical approaches. Does your situation require public moral leadership? Then a communicative ethic is best. Does your situation require the development of countercultural moral character? Then a witness ethic is best. Does your situation require ethical consciousness-raising and organizing for social justice? Then a liberationist ethic is best. Does your situation require genuine moral conversation and the discernment of shared commitments in spite of our differences? Then a hospitality ethic is best. Each ethical approach is briefly and carefully explored, correlated with appropriate contexts and situations, and demonstrated with model sermons. The result is a useful handbook for quickly discerning what ethical approach is needed, how to preach that approach, and what to expect as a result.

“In a time when responsible, clear-headed Christian ethical praxis and reflection have never been more crucial, this is a book that belongs on every preacher’s desk. . . . McClure devotes chapters to each of four distinctive approaches to Christian ethics in the pulpit: communicative ethics, ‘witness’ ethics, liberation ethics, and ‘hospitality’ ethics. . . . McClure not only lays out the primary theological/theoretical commitments and aims of a specific approach to ethical reflection, but proposes concrete practices for active ethical engagement beyond the church walls, as well as key homiletical strategies commensurate with the approach under discussion.”
—Sally A. Brown, Princeton Theological Seminary
